A instrument offering estimated bills related to fuel hearth operation sometimes considers elements akin to fuel costs, hearth effectivity, and utilization length. For instance, such a instrument would possibly enable customers to enter their native fuel price, the British Thermal Items (BTUs) of their hearth, and the estimated hours of use per day to calculate anticipated day by day or month-to-month operating prices.
Understanding operational bills is essential for knowledgeable family budgeting and power consumption administration.
